Regular Cleaning
Keeping the otter bath chair clean is crucial for both hygiene and aesthetics. We should establish a routine cleaning schedule to prevent the buildup of soap scum or mildew:
- Use mild soap: Opt for gentle detergents that won’t damage the material.
- Rinse thoroughly: After cleaning, make sure to rinse off any soap residue with warm water.
- Dry properly: Wipe down the chair with a soft cloth before storing it away to avoid moisture retention.
Inspecting for Wear and Tear
Periodic checks for signs of wear can help us catch potential issues before they become major problems. Here’s what we should look out for:
- Structural integrity: Examine joints and supports regularly for cracks or looseness.
- Surface damage: Look for scratches or abrasions that could compromise safety.
- Functional components: Ensure all adjustable features operate smoothly without obstruction.
Proper Storage
When not in use, how we store the otter bath chair can greatly affect its lifespan:
- Keep it dry: Storing in a damp environment can lead to mold growth; consider using dry storage areas when possible.
- Avoid heavy stacking: If space allows, position chairs upright rather than stacking them heavily on top of one another to prevent deformation.
